Exchange of information
In the world of finance, tax treaties play a crucial role in ensuring the proper exchange of information between countries. These treaties often include a provision that allows one country's tax authorities to request information from the other country's tax authorities on a specific taxpayer. However, it's important to note that this information can only be used for tax purposes and must be kept confidential. In other words, it can only be shared with those involved in the assessment or collection of taxes covered by the treaty. This ensures a fair and transparent process for all parties involved.
